Compressed air contains 79% nitrogen, which serves as both the raw material for nitrogen generation by the nitrogen generator and the source of energy consumption for the generator to achieve the production of high-purity nitrogen (99.999%).
Pressure swing adsorption (PSA) nitrogen generation technology utilizes the selective adsorption characteristics of carbon molecular sieves. It employs a cyclic process of pressure adsorption and depressurization desorption, allowing compressed air to enter the adsorption tower alternately to achieve the separation of oxygen and nitrogen in the air. This process enables the continuous and stable production of high-purity product nitrogen.

Application fields and purposes of nitrogen generator
Electronics industry: Nitrogen protection for the production of semiconductors and electronic components.
Heat treatment: bright annealing, protective heating, sintering of powder metallurgy magnetic materials, etc.
Coal industry: The explosion-proof box underground is used for fire prevention and extinguishment every day.
Chemical industry: nitrogen blanketing, replacement, cleaning, pressure conveying, chemical reaction agitation, protection in chemical fiber production, etc.
Petroleum and natural gas industry: petroleum refining, nitrogen filling and purging of containers, pipelines, and leak detection boxes. Nitrogen injection for oil extraction.
Pharmaceutical industry: nitrogen-filled storage for Chinese and Western medicines, pneumatic conveying of nitrogen-filled medicinal materials, etc.
Cable industry: production of protective gas for cross-linked cables.
Other: metallurgical industry, rubber industry, aerospace industry, new energy, shipbuilding, tires, and many other fields.
